NEW DELHI: A leading California-based electric air taxi company, Archer Aviation, that is backed by the likes of Boeing, United Airlines and auto major Stellantis plans to provide urban air mobility (UAM) in Indian cities before the end of this decade. Its pilot plus four-passenger electric vertical take off and landing (eVTOL) vehicle Midnight that has a range of about 150 km is expected to enter commercial service in 2025 in the US.
